As a core ultra-fine grinding machine, the
universal disc nano sand mill relies on high-speed agitation of professional grinding media (sand or beads) to generate powerful shear force, impact force and friction force inside the grinding chamber. Through continuous mechanical action, large material particles are fully dispersed, crushed and refined, realizing precise micron-level particle size processing. Different from traditional grinding equipment, the LSM-A series adopts an eccentric disc grinding structure that drives grinding media to move uniformly throughout the entire grinding cylinder, ensuring full contact between materials and media and eliminating dead grinding zones, which guarantees uniform particle fineness of finished products.
The LSM-A Series single-pass universal disc sand mill features standardized and reliable technical parameters to meet precise production requirements. It supports a flexible finished fineness range from 5μm to 20μm, covering most conventional ultra-fine processing demands for industrial materials. The equipment is compatible with grinding media of ≥0.9mm, achieving balanced grinding efficiency and product quality. The optimized single-pass grinding design simplifies the production process, effectively avoiding material over-grinding and ensuring stable and consistent batch product quality.
